Display Glue Strips Not Holding in Lower Right Corner
It was a fun project:
I converted a 27" iMac into a 5K display using a special display driver board from AliExpress. I did a good job removing and cleaning the old glue strips before applying the new iFixit glue strips.
When setting the display back on the case I had to make a couple of lateral position adjustments and while doing so lifted the display from the bottom glue strip where it had been very briefly attached. Not sure if that's the source of my problem...
What I'm seeing is that the glue is holding well except for that lower right corner, where the display seems to be slightly lifting away from the case, for maybe about 4-6" from that corner.
I keep pushing it back in place and it seems to hold briefly, but eventually curls slightly away in that corner. My concern is that the problem could grow and the display actually fall off the case. So...
My question: is there some way I can reglue/fix that lower right corner without removing everything and starting over.
